From Events to Entrepreneurialism with Eleonora Rocca

This week our host Steve McGarry sits down with Eleonora Rocca, the Founder of WomenX Impact and Co-Founder and Chief Marketing Officer for Horizone Group. The two start the show talking about her background in entrepreneurialism, and how creating a blog was at the beginning of it all. They talk about what it was like for her event brand Digital Innovation Days to grow at the rate that it did, and how the initial conversation about exiting began. Eleonora talks about the importance of really knowing your numbers in and out, and the details about your business that you may not always concern yourself with but might be very valuable to those interested.


Eleonora Rocca founded the annual Digital Innovation Days Event (Former Mashable Social Media Day) in Milan in 2014, which is now one of the largest Italian events about Digital Marketing, Social Media, and Innovation Topics. Eleonora is also the Co-Founder and Chief Marketing Officer for Horizone Group, which is a marketing company that provides strategic counsel on their clients’ marketing and brand strategies.

YOUR HOST

Steve McGarry

An entrepreneur, content creator, and investor based in sunny Tampa, Florida. In 2015, while living in San Francisco, Steve sold his first fintech startup LendLayer to Max Levchin’s (founder of PayPal) consumer finance company Affirm.
